The Afterlight rewards its viewers with a thoughtful, in-depth portrait of a couple unraveling. Sometimes running away from the city for the safety of upstate countryside isn't always the best call -- and Andrew (an always wonderful Mike Kelly) and Claire (Jicky Schnee) unfortunately figure that out the hard way.

Minimalist performances by Rip Torn and Ana Asensio alone make this film worth viewing.

Co-directors Macneill and Kaleina should be commended for their restraint. Hiring Mother Nature as their production designer was a smart call, focusing on the rusty calm of small town living. Punctuated with moments of quiet tension, one could almost view The Afterlight as what The Shining would've been like if it had been directed by Terrence Malick.
